Exploring the Future of Automation Testing in Software Development

The Future of Software Program Advancement: Harnessing the Possible of Automation Evaluating for Faster, More Trusted Releases



The potential advantages of automation testing are huge, appealing not only to speed up release cycles however additionally to boost the general high quality and uniformity of software application items. In a landscape where rate and accuracy are vital, utilizing the abilities of automation screening stands as a crucial strategy for staying ahead.


The Power of Automation Evaluating



In the realm of software development, the implementation of automation testing has actually verified to significantly enhance efficiency and top quality assurance procedures. By automating recurring and taxing hand-operated screening jobs, software program groups can enhance their screening efforts, reduce human mistakes, and increase the total growth lifecycle. Automation testing permits the fast implementation of test cases across different atmospheres and setups, offering developers with fast comments on the high quality of their code changes.


One of the vital benefits of automation screening is its capacity to boost test protection, guaranteeing that more attributes and functionalities are completely tested. This thorough screening strategy helps recognize defects early in the advancement cycle, minimizing the chance of expensive insects getting to manufacturing. In addition, automation screening promotes continual combination and constant shipment practices, allowing teams to launch software updates much more frequently and accurately.


Accelerating Release Cycles



The velocity of launch cycles in software advancement is important for remaining competitive in the quickly evolving tech landscape. Shortening the time between launches allows business to react swiftly to market demands, include user comments without delay, and surpass competitors in supplying ingenious functions. By leveraging and embracing dexterous methodologies automation testing devices, growth teams can enhance their procedures, recognize bugs earlier, and guarantee a better product with each launch.


Increasing launch cycles additionally makes it possible for software application business to preserve an one-upmanship by swiftly resolving security susceptabilities and adjusting to altering governing requirements. Furthermore, regular releases assist in structure consumer trust and commitment as individuals profit from constant enhancements and pest solutions. This iterative technique promotes a culture of continuous improvement within development teams, motivating partnership, advancement, and a concentrate on delivering worth to end-users.


Guaranteeing Constant Quality Control



Constant top quality assurance includes a methodical approach to screening and reviewing software application to recognize and correct any defects or problems quickly. This consists of specifying clear high quality standards, carrying out thorough screening at each stage of growth, and leveraging automation screening devices to simplify the process.


Conquering Common Testing Difficulties



Dealing with and dealing with typical testing obstacles is essential for guaranteeing the efficiency and performance of software application growth processes. This concern can be mitigated by complete test planning, including diverse screening methods, and leveraging automation screening to enhance insurance coverage. Additionally, collaborating testing efforts throughout different teams and divisions can pose a difficulty due to interaction voids and varying top priorities.


Implementing Automation Testing Methods



automation testingautomation testing
Having actually successfully browsed usual testing challenges, the next critical emphasis lies in efficiently implementing automation screening to enhance software application development procedures. Automation testing strategies entail making use of specialized tools and structures to automate repeated jobs, lower hands-on intervention, and enhance the rate and accuracy of screening. To execute automation screening successfully, an extensive strategy needs to be established, beginning with determining the right test her comment is here instances for automation based on standards such as frequency of intricacy, use, and urgency.




Once the examination cases are chosen, groups need to invest time in developing robust examination manuscripts that are maintainable, recyclable, and scalable. Cooperation in between testers, developers, and stakeholders is crucial to make sure that the automation screening straightens with the general task goals and requirements. Continual combination and implementation pipelines can further enhance the automation screening procedure by immediately causing tests whenever new code is committed. By adopting automation screening strategies, software program growth teams can achieve quicker examining cycles, greater examination protection, and inevitably provide even more dependable software application releases.


Final Thought



In verdict, automation screening gives an effective device for speeding up release cycles, making sure consistent quality control, and conquering typical screening obstacles in software program growth. By using the possibility of automation screening methods, companies can attain faster and extra Our site reliable launches. automation testing. Embracing automation testing is necessary for remaining affordable in the busy globe of software development


automation testingautomation testing
By automating time-consuming and repetitive manual testing tasks, software groups can enhance their testing initiatives, minimize human mistakes, and increase the total growth lifecycle.Having actually successfully browsed common testing difficulties, the next calculated focus exists in effectively executing automation testing to enhance software advancement processes. Automation testing techniques involve the usage of specialized tools and frameworks to automate repetitive tasks, lower hand-operated intervention, and enhance the speed and accuracy of screening. To apply automation testing effectively, go now a comprehensive strategy needs to be created, starting with determining the best examination situations for automation based on criteria such as regularity of intricacy, urgency, and usage.


In conclusion, automation screening provides an effective device for increasing release cycles, guaranteeing regular top quality assurance, and getting over usual screening difficulties in software application growth.

Leave a Reply

Your email address will not be published. Required fields are marked *